发明名称 |
Carbon fiber reinforced polypropylene resin composition with excellent molding property |
摘要 |
The present invention provides a carbon fiber reinforced polypropylene resin composition with improved molding property. In particular, provided is a carbon fiber reinforced polypropylene resin composition with significantly improved molding property, tensile strength, flexural strength and the like by adding a modified polypropylene grafted with maleic anhydride as a compatibilizer to a polypropylene resin to reinforce the carbon fiber. |

主权项 |
1. A polypropylene resin composition, comprising:
an amount of about 50 to about 80 wt % of a polypropylene resin as a homopolymer of propylene or a propylene-ethylene copolymer; an amount of about 1 to about 10 wt % of a modified polypropylene as a compatibilizer; and an amount of about 15 to about 40 wt % of carbon fiber, based on the total weight of the polypropylene resin composition, wherein the polypropylene resin has a melt index (MI) of about 20 to about 100 g/10 min at a temperature of about 230° C., a molecular weight distribution (MWD) of about 5 to about 10 and an isotactic index of about 97 to about 100, and wherein the modified polypropylene has a maleic anhydride graft ratio of about 5 to 11 wt %. |
